Good Times

Walt Disney World Sunday at 7
Street lights on at 9
Remember the family dinners
We had nothing but time

A game of Life on the table
Slap Jack on the floor
Metal roller skates
People knocking on the door

Happy Days every day of the week
8-tracks in the player
School was actually fun
Top seller was “Bayer”

Popcorn balls stuck to your teeth
Movies and a best friend
I miss the good ‘ol days
A letter in the mail to send.

The world goes racing by
Yet I stand perfectly still
I know that everything will come back to me
Always has and always will.
